Subject: Re: [PATCH v3 14/17] exynos: fimg2d: fix comment for G2D_COEFF_MODE_GB_COLOR

Hi Tobias,
On 2015년 02월 24일 23:20, Tobias Jakobi wrote:
> The coefficient mode enables use of global color, not alpha.
>
> Signed-off-by: Tobias Jakobi <tjakobi@math.uni-bielefeld.de>
> ---
> exynos/exynos_fimg2d.h | 2 +-
> 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
>
> diff --git a/exynos/exynos_fimg2d.h b/exynos/exynos_fimg2d.h
> index dbcb764..418757f 100644
> --- a/exynos/exynos_fimg2d.h
> +++ b/exynos/exynos_fimg2d.h
> @@ -159,7 +159,7 @@ enum e_g2d_coeff_mode {
> G2D_COEFF_MODE_DST_COLOR,
> /* Global Alpha : Set by ALPHA_REG(0x618) */
> G2D_COEFF_MODE_GB_ALPHA,
> - /* Global Alpha : Set by ALPHA_REG(0x618) */
> + /* Global Color : Set by ALPHA_REG(0x618) */
Actually, above register sets not only global color value but also
global alpha value. Below shows fields of the register,
ColorValue [31:8] Global color value (RGB order)
AlphaValue [7:0] Global alpha value
So right comment would be "Global Color and Global Alpha".
Thanks,
Inki Dae
> G2D_COEFF_MODE_GB_COLOR,
> /* (1-SRC alpha)/DST Alpha */
> G2D_COEFF_MODE_DISJOINT_S,
